Title: Zhaojing Zhong: Innovator in Immunology
Introduction
Zhaojing Zhong is a prominent inventor based in the Bronx, NY. He has made significant contributions to the field of immunology, holding a total of 2 patents. His work focuses on developing innovative therapeutic agents that enhance immune responses against various diseases.
Latest Patents
Zhong's latest patents include groundbreaking inventions in immunomodulatory agents. One patent provides antibodies that specifically bind to PD-L1 and fusion molecules comprising PD-L1 binding proteins constructed with an IL15 receptor-binding domain. These agents inhibit PD-L1-mediated immunosuppression and enhance cell and cytokine-mediated immunity for the treatment of neoplastic and infectious diseases. Another patent describes human antipneumococcal antibodies produced in non-human animals that specifically bind to capsular polysaccharide (PPS-3). This invention includes methods for producing these antibodies and pharmaceutical compositions for treating infections caused by such pathogens.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Zhaojing Zhong has worked with notable companies such as Abgenix, Inc. and Kadmon Corporation, LLC.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to develop and refine his innovative ideas in the field of immunology.
Collaborations
Zhong has collaborated with esteemed colleagues, including Liise-anne Pirofski and Qing Chang. These partnerships have contributed to the advancement of his research and the successful development of his patents.
